In this quest to get rid of the conditions bring about skepticism, war and self-destruction, Scientology is no various than all the various other missionary or evangelical religions, specifically, Buddhism, Judaism, Christianity and Islam.




Those three facets are (a) its missionary personality, (b) its universality, and (c) its top quality of utmost problem and commitment. (a) First, Scientology's religious quest is envisioned in regards to a spiritual goal, dealt with and available to one and all. Therefore, the prophets of the Bible such as Amos, Isaiah and Jeremiah, got revelations that they had a goal to attend to the nations everywhere about peace, justice and love.


onward picked up a calling to spread the message of the Buddha throughout the Far East, including China, Indochina, Indonesia, Korea and Japan. Today, Japanese Buddhist missionaries are spreading their message to Europe and the Americas. So likewise, Jesus of Nazareth saw his gospel as having a missionary objective; for this reason he sent his devotees unto all the nations.


In its devotion to "Clear" the world in order to bring about a new civilization, Scientology's missionary initiatives adjust entirely to the pattern of the excellent historic faiths. (b) Secondly, Scientology sees its mission in universal terms. Consequently, it has set out to open up goal centers in all parts of the globe in order to make the auditing and training innovation generally readily available.

Today, Muslims are developing full-scale mosques in cities including London, Los Angeles, Toronto, and even Seoul because they think in the universal worth of words of the Prophet Muhammed. Likewise, Buddhist and Hindu Vedanta spiritual leaders are bringing their spiritual mentors and kinds of life to our coasts since they are convinced that their trainings have an universal application.

 

 

 

 


Each of the excellent historical religious beliefs has a central core of teaching which gives its fans a compelling inspiration to fulfill its spiritual mission on a globally scale and with a feeling of necessity and ultimacy. For the Buddhist that core training is summed up in the spiritual concept of "launch" (moksa) from the ensnaring bonds of desire and the bestowal of bliss in egoless thought (nirvana).


The ultimacy of this awakening is what motivated and motivates every Buddhist monk and missionary. As I have actually noted over, the Scientology belief in past lives is carefully pertaining to the Buddhist concept of samsara; furthermore, the Scientology concept of "Clearing" has close fondness with the Buddhist idea in moksa.
